- Title
Effect of Recasting on the Quality of Dental Alloys: A Review.
- Authors
Bandela, Vinod; Kanaparthi, Saraswathi
- Abstract
Objectives: The purpose of this systematic review was to assess the effects of remelting dental alloys on the physical and mechanical properties and possible advantages and disadvantages of using the recasted base metal alloys. Study Selection: The systematic review included the studies on dental alloy recasting. MEDLINE, Science Direct, Dentistry and Oral Science Source were searched. Data extracted and the quality of studies were assessed. Data: 44 studies published were reviewed in the current article. The number of recastings for dental alloys ranged from 1 to 10. The percentage of new alloy ranged from 0 to 100 wt%, although the mean value was 50 wt%. The properties like biocompatibility, color, castability, porosities and marginal fit of the recasted alloys. Conclusion: Dental casting alloys have found wide spread usage in restorative dentistry due to their desirable physical, biological and economical properties. The recasting of previously casted alloy is a routine procedure in dental laboratories. The procedure is practiced worldwide mainly due to economic reason and to prevent wastage of natural resources and environmental protection. It will be of definite advantage if the properties of the recast alloys are studied in detail and directions given to Prosthodontist and technicians without compromising the optimum properties of the alloy. Clinical Significance: Recasting of dental alloys is practiced worldwide. This is mainly due to economic reasons and protection of environment. This article reviewed on various properties of dental alloys and recasting could be acceptable only if at least 50% of new alloy should be added during each recasting procedure.
